#176AC2 Hex color

#176AC2

The hexadecimal color code #176AC2 corresponds to the code RGB( 23, 106, 194 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,09 level), green (at 0,42 level) and blue (at 0,76 level). Its brightness is 42% and its saturation is 78%. It is composed of red at 7%, green at 32% and blue at 60%.
